Speed & Performance

  • Compress and properly size every image before upload
  • Use a fast, reliable hosting provider — don't underspend here
  • Minimize third-party scripts that slow down page load
  • Test your site speed on mobile specifically, not just desktop

Design & UX

  • Design mobile-first, since most visitors arrive on mobile
  • Keep navigation simple — visitors shouldn't have to think about where to click
  • Use real photography over generic stock images wherever possible
  • Make your phone number and contact details visible on every page

Conversion & Trust

  • Every page needs one clear, obvious call-to-action
  • Show real testimonials, reviews, or case studies above the fold if possible
  • Keep contact forms short — every extra field reduces completion rate
  • Add trust signals: certifications, years in business, client logos
  • Make sure your site is secure (HTTPS) — browsers now flag insecure sites clearly
  • Test your own contact form regularly to make sure it still works
  • Review analytics monthly to see where visitors actually drop off
